Read moreEquilibrium and kinetics of sorption of Zn (II) ions from aqueous solutions of pH 5 on indigene (Romanian) peat moss were investigated in batch system. The experimental equilibrium sorption data at three temperatures were analysed by Freundlich, Langmuir, Tempkin and Dubinin-Radushkevich sorption isotherm models. Read moreAn original strategy was set-up in order to develop new azo compounds which incorporate in their structure 4,4'- diaminodiphenylmethane (DADFM) and low molecular weight maltodextrine. The synthesis of the model compounds involved the functionalisation of DADFM with the maltodextrine, the conversion of amino functionalized maltodextrine in a diazonium salt and the coupling of reaction with H and R acids. Read moreA theoretical analysis of CTs behavior has been developed by means of the equivalent circuit. The CTs performance under distorted conditions is usually characterized by means of the frequency response test. Models of the instrument transformers are especially important for studying CT saturation, ferro-resonance phenomena, harmonics and sub-harmonics and their effect on the performance of protective relaying.
